Rachel Craddy is a Senior Associate in the Residential Property Department based in Exeter. With over 13 years’ experience, Rachel has vast practical knowledge of all aspects of conveyancing and has advised on: Residential conveyancing; Rectifying deeds; Woodland; Restrictive covenants; Development plots; Deeds of Grant; Transfers of parts; Unregistered land; Leasehold enfranchisement; Right to buy / social housing; Matrimonial. Rachel’s experience includes: Acting for clients acquiring a site for residential development, then drafting and dealing with the subsequent individual plot sales and management company set up for the communal areas; Acting in the surrender and re-grant of residential leases from a resident-owned management company, including re-drawing plans to reflect the individual demised premises, negotiating service charge proportions and maintenance responsibilities; Drafting deeds to assist in the grant, release or variation of easements e.g. rights of way, and covenants (restrictions on use of a property); Lease extensions for both landlords and tenants on a consensual basis; Rural conveyancing including flying freeholds, septic tanks, conversions, listed buildings, S157 residency restrictions. Rachel is a member of Women in Property and also the Devon & Somerset Law Society.
